Yoruba football Emmanuel Adebayor welcomes Kanu and Okocha to Togo, set to retire with testimonial.
Togolese football legend Emmanuel Adebayor is scheduled to formally declare his retirement from professional football.
The accomplishments of the former CAF Player of the Year Award winner will be highlighted over a three-day event.
For the Testimonial, Super Eagles of Nigeria icons Jay Jay Okocha and Kanu Nwankwo have arrived in Togo.
Nigerian icons Okocha and Kanu were greeted wit by Adebayor as soon as they landed in Lome, the capital of Togo.
The events started on Friday, October 25, and will end on Sunday, October 27 with an exhibition game at Kegue Stadium.

Emmanuel Adebayor welcomes Kanu and Okocha
The former Real Madrid striker took to social media to celebrate the arrival of the Nigerian football legends.
Along with a video of their arrival was a message that said, "What a joy to host Nigerian football magician, Jay-Jay Okocha, and my idol, the great legend Kanu Nwankwo in Lomé!
"It's an honour to share these moments with these icons of African football. Thanks for being here to celebrate with us! #sea #seajubilee #seafoundation."
Alex Song of Cameroon and Ghanaian icon Asamoah Gyan are among the other well-known celebrities who have come for the occasion.
A few months ago, Emmanuel Adebayor debuted his SEA house, and he plans to keep up his charitable endeavors.
